While the surname Kivler is not among the most common surnames in the world, it still has a presence in certain regions. According to data from the United States and Russia, the surname Kivler has been recorded in both countries, with a higher incidence in the United States.
In the United States, the surname Kivler has been recorded with an incidence of 189 individuals bearing the surname. This suggests that there are a significant number of individuals with the surname Kivler living in the United States, particularly in regions with a history of Eastern European immigration.
In Russia, the surname Kivler is much less common, with an incidence of only 2 individuals bearing the surname. This suggests that the surname Kivler may have a more limited presence in Russia, possibly due to historical migration patterns or other factors impacting surname distribution.
